🐾❤️ What medications are used during a goodbye visit?
Many families wonder what the process involves and whether their pet will be comfortable throughout the visit.
At EverLoved Veterinary, Dr. Kristin Crocker uses a comfort-first approach designed to help pets remain calm, relaxed, and peaceful. The process begins with a gentle oral medication applied to your pet's gums to help reduce anxiety and promote relaxation.
Once your pet is comfortable, a carefully selected combination of sedatives and pain-relieving medications is administered to help them drift into a deep, restful sleep. During this stage, pets are completely relaxed and unaware of their surroundings, allowing families to spend quiet, meaningful moments together.
After your pet is fully asleep, an additional medication is administered to gently help the body come to rest. Because pets are already in a deep state of sleep, they remain peaceful and unaware throughout this last step.

After a companion passes, other pets may feel the loss too.
You might notice changes in behavior—more quiet moments, searching, or wanting to stay
close.
These are natural responses as they adjust to a new routine without their friend.
With time, patience, and love, most pets begin to settle again. Keeping familiar routines and
offering comfort can help them feel safe during this transition.
